*Speaker: *David Pereñiguez (Madrid, IFT)
*Title: *Love Numbers and Magnetic Susceptibility of Charged Black Holes
*Date: *Wednesday, January 26th at 3pm CET
*Location: *Zoom (see below)
*Abstract:*
Four-dimensional black holes (BH) of GR do not deform under external
fields. This is a very special result of 4D, and ceases to hold in higher
dimensions. In this talk I will discuss the gravitational and magnetic
response of charged BHs in arbitrary spacetime dimensions D. First, I will
derive exact analytical expressions for the tensor Love numbers in terms of
the BH temperature. These turn out to vanish at extremality. In contrast,
vector Love numbers and magnetic susceptibilities increase significantly as
one approaches the maximally charged limit. I will provide exact analytical
expressions at extremality and solve numerically the finite-temperature and
finite-charge case, obtaining agreement with our results at zero
temperature and those previously known for the neutral limit. In D=4 all
response parameters remain zero at all temperatures. I will conclude by
discussing aspects that could be explored in future work.
